Firebirds post a perfect OHL debut

The Flint Firebirds didn’t waste any time recording its first Ontario Hockey League victory Thursday (Sept. 24)

Goaltender Zack Bowman, 18, from Ontario turned aside every one of the 24 shots he faced as the Firebirds made its league debut with a 3-0 win at Saginaw’s Dow Event Center against the host Spirit.

While Bowman kept his crease clear, Ryan Moore, 18, from Troy, MI and Nicholas Casmano, 17, from Ontario  scored late first period goals — Casmano a shorthanded tally — to provide the team will all of the offense it would need.

Just to make sure though, Will Bitten, 17, from Ontario added one more for the Firebirds, on a powerplay late in the second period to finish off the scoring.

Evan Cormier started in goal for the Spirit, 17, from Ontario turned aside 27 of 30 shots in the game.

The same two teams will square off again on Saturday (Sept. 26), this time at the Dort Federal Event Center in Flint.
